0

私のウェブサイトは Asp.Net C# です。

私は自分のウェブサイトにペイパルを使用しています。ロゴデザイン、パンフレットデザインなど複数の商品を持っています。サービスごとに異なるBuyNowボタンを使用しています。

支払いが成功した後、ユーザーを continue.aspx ページに送り返します。

しかし、とにかく私のcontinue.aspxページにOrderIdを受け取ることができるという1つのことについて混乱していますか? continue.aspx ページでその特定の注文の詳細を取得して、会社名や要件などの設計の説明を追加する必要があります。

支払いが成功した後、continue.aspx で orderId をクエリ文字列として受け取る方法はありますか?

4

1 に答える 1

0

ウェブ ペイメント スタンダードまたはエクスプレス チェックアウトを使用していますか? エクスプレス チェックアウトを使用しているようですが、標準を使用している場合は、チェックアウト フローをより詳細に制御できるため、エクスプレス チェックアウトに切り替えることをお勧めします。エクスプレス チェックアウトでは、購入者が支払いに同意した後にサイトに送り返されたときに、サイトが GetExpressCheckoutDetails API 呼び出しを実行します。この API 呼び出しでバイヤー情報を取得します。そこから、購入者に実際に請求する API 呼び出しである DoExpressCheckoutPayment API 呼び出しを実行する前に、購入者に追加のオプションなどを提示できます。

于 2013-04-22T13:45:12.190 に答える